Overview
At the last stop of the Daiyuzan Line (Izuhakone Railway), which started its service in 1925 (Taisho 14), is the Daiyuzan Saijoji Temple, which gave this station its name. From New Year's Eve to New Year’s Day the trains and buses of the Daiyuzan Line operate overnight.
